/// Parameters for clearing read or acknowledged mailbox messages.
#[derive(Debug, Clone)]
pub struct ClearQuery {
    pub home_dir: PathBuf,
    pub current_dir: PathBuf,
    pub actor_override: Option<AgentName>,
    pub target_address: Option<String>,
    pub team_override: Option<TeamName>,
    pub older_than: Option<Duration>,
    pub idle_only: bool,
    pub dry_run: bool,
}

/// Counts of removed mailbox messages by ATM display class.
#[derive(Debug, Clone, Default, Serialize)]
pub struct RemovedByClass {
    pub acknowledged: usize,
    pub read: usize,
}

/// Result of one mailbox cleanup command.
#[derive(Debug, Clone, Serialize)]
pub struct ClearOutcome {
    pub action: &'static str,
    pub team: TeamName,
    pub agent: AgentName,
    pub removed_total: usize,
    pub remaining_total: usize,
    pub removed_by_class: RemovedByClass,
}

/// Remove read or acknowledged messages from one mailbox surface.
///
/// # Errors
///
/// Returns [`AtmError`] with
/// [`crate::error_codes::AtmErrorCode::IdentityUnavailable`],
/// [`crate::error_codes::AtmErrorCode::TeamUnavailable`],
/// [`crate::error_codes::AtmErrorCode::TeamNotFound`],
/// [`crate::error_codes::AtmErrorCode::AgentNotFound`],
/// [`crate::error_codes::AtmErrorCode::AddressParseFailed`],
/// [`crate::error_codes::AtmErrorCode::MailboxReadFailed`],
/// [`crate::error_codes::AtmErrorCode::MailboxWriteFailed`],
/// [`crate::error_codes::AtmErrorCode::MailboxLockFailed`],
/// [`crate::error_codes::AtmErrorCode::MailboxLockTimeout`], or
/// [`crate::error_codes::AtmErrorCode::MessageValidationFailed`] when actor or
/// target resolution fails, the team or agent cannot be validated, shared
/// mailbox locks cannot be acquired, or the selected source files cannot be
/// persisted safely.
pub fn clear_mail(
    query: ClearQuery,
    observability: &dyn ObservabilityPort,
) -> Result<ClearOutcome, AtmError> {

fn is_clearable(message: &SourcedMessage, cutoff: Option<DateTime<Utc>>, idle_only: bool) -> bool {
    let class = state::classify_message(&message.envelope);
    matches!(class, MessageClass::Read | MessageClass::Acknowledged)
        && cutoff
            .map(|cutoff| message.envelope.timestamp.into_inner() <= cutoff)
            .unwrap_or(true)
        && (!idle_only || is_idle_notification(&message.envelope))
}

fn is_idle_notification(message: &MessageEnvelope) -> bool {
    // Claude Code currently defines idle notifications as JSON encoded in the
    // native `text` field. Do not replace this with an ATM-local schema here;
    // any ownership change must be documented in docs/claude-code-message-schema.md.
    serde_json::from_str::<Value>(&message.text)
        .ok()
        .map(|value| value.get("type").and_then(Value::as_str) == Some("idle_notification"))
        .unwrap_or(false)
}
